Trip Overview

Lorain, OH to Liberty Center, OH is 112.8 miles and takes about 2h 12m via Ohio Turnpike, with a fuel budget near $18 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This trip stays within Ohio, moving across the Midwest region. It's a straightforward drive, primarily on highways, making it a convenient option for a single-day journey. With an estimated fuel cost of $18, it's an economical choice for a short road trip.

Trip Plan

Given the relatively short duration of 2 hours and 12 minutes, you can depart anytime that suits your schedule. The longest stretch without a major change in road is 75.7 miles on the Ohio Turnpike, so plan for a single fuel stop if needed, though the $18 budget suggests you might not need to refuel. Consider leaving in the morning to maximize daylight, especially if you plan any brief stops along the way. Keep an eye out for potential toll sections on the Ohio Turnpike as you make your way west.
